Pastoral Care Director - Nursing Home jobs in Pascagoula, MS

Pastoral Care Director - Nursing Home may perform duties of chaplain, which includes counseling and visiting, for a nursing home. Develops and provides services designed to meet the religious and/or spiritual needs of patients and their families and nursing home employees. Being a Pastoral Care Director - Nursing Home may require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to top management. To be a Pastoral Care Director - Nursing Home typically requires 7+ years of related experience. A specialist on complex technical and business matters. Work is highly independent. May assume a team lead role for the work group.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Pascagoula is a city in Jackson County, Mississippi, United States. It is the principal city of the Pascagoula Metropolitan Statistical Area, as a part of the Gulfport–Biloxi–Pascagoula Combined Statistical Area. The population was 22,392 at the 2010 census, down from 26,200 at the 2000 census. As of 2016 the estimated population was 21,981. It is the county seat of Jackson County. Pascagoula is a major industrial city of Mississippi, on the Gulf Coast. Prior to World War II, the town was a sleepy fishing village of about 5,000.
